Output 505162177f85f7711891ec40c5487ab5691559a361260fdaec335fc5bab7e85d:1

value
8998082
script pubkey
OP_0 OP_PUSHBYTES_20 e57557090dc9482a61caa8eaa82b0328e5f23158
address
bc1qu464wzgde9yz5cw24r42s2cr9rjlyv2c9p353e
transaction
505162177f85f7711891ec40c5487ab5691559a361260fdaec335fc5bab7e85d
spent
true